What Makes You Think That Stress and Hair Loss are utterly Related?

Physical or emotional stress, illness, injury, and surgery are prime contributors to the growing hair fall mechanism. Stress can have a direct or indirect impact on your hair follicles and can contribute to hair loss. Sometimes the hair fall can start around 6-12 weeks after a stressful incident.

What can be the possible types of hair loss due to stress?

Telogen Effluvium

In Telogen effluvium disease, the hair follicles move to the resting or telogen phase due to excessive stress. In normal instances, about 5-10 % of hair is always in the resting phase. But with telogen effluvium conditions, the percentage exceeds and more than 100 strands are lost every day.

Trichotillomania

Trichotillomania or hair-pulling disorder can be caused due to tremendous stress, fretfulness, depression, boredom, and annoyance. A person involves in pulling out hair from the scalp, eyebrows, and lashes which is followed by thinning of hair on the scalp.

Alopecia Areata

Alopecia areata is a condition where there are bald patches of hair on the scalp due to stress. In this condition, the body’s immune system hits its hair follicles.
